The sample becomes a verified twin, in just over a minute
One button on the SamplR device. Photo, Measure and Scan modes capture the material under four lighting geometries, with automatic background removal and a 4K behavior video at 60 fps, so a buyer sees how the fabric moves and not only how it sits. Out comes a set of color-managed PBR maps: diffuse albedo, alpha, normal, glossiness, specular albedo and displacement.
SamplR captures appearance, which means color, gloss, structure and surface. It does not produce spectral data. Spectral color approval runs in MatchBox, and the two are deliberately separate.

Company Connect →Your fabric, dropped into the garment before it exists
The same asset goes into CLO3D, Browzwear, Style3D and comparable tools. The glTF export carries both halves: the appearance maps and the physical properties that land in the physical property tab and drive how the garment falls. Drag and drop into a 3D window moves the appearance maps only, so the simulation looks close and behaves wrong.
Displacement values still have to be set by hand in CLO, and no PBR format in this industry carries a color standard inside it. That is a property of the formats, not of one vendor.

A generative model has no idea what your fabric is. It invents something plausible. Anchored to a verified capture, generated imagery starts from the real structure, the real gloss and the real color, which turns AI from a mood tool into a way of showing a customer their product in your material. AI running on unreliable material data scales the error rather than the output.
A generated image is a sales and communication asset. It is never an approval, and it does not replace a measurement. Keep the two roles apart and both stay credible.
